Laos Casinos

Set in between Thailand and Vietnam, Laos is one of the true beauties of Southeast Asia. Though some parts of it may not be as developed as its Indochina neighbors, there is one spot where it has managed to keep up – gambling den gaming.

The Dansavanh Casino is situated in Ban Muang Wa-Tha, Vientiane Province. This Laos gambling hall brings in many jobs for the citizens, who at times do not always have an opportunity to make a decent income. The Dansavanh Casino is completely reliant upon tourists in order to make a profit. Locals generally only work at the casinos and do not bet their earnings on gambling. Because neighboring countries such as Thailand are cluttered with blaring, extravagant gambling dens, Dansavanh Casino concentrates more on vacationers from China, which borders Laos on the Northeastern tip.

The Chinese government has always been decidedly against wagering, especially inside its own borders. This is why nations like Laos can run gambling halls and be immediately successful–players from different countries. Because gambling is so taboo in China, the travelers travel to gambling dens in exhilaration to alleviate their curiosity, and they generally spend very big. Laos gambling halls have long benefited from this style of gaming.

Gambling den gambling in Laos features a lot of of the same table games that you would see at most other casinos around the planet. Games such as blackjack, baccarat banque, roulette, slot machines, and video poker can be located in the gambling dens. You can likely even have private or public table games to compete at, if you like.

Due to the astonishing resort communities and the ability to gamble within its borders, Laos will endure to be a big player in the Southeast Asia tourist business. More waterfront properties and even resortgambling halls are in the early development stage and are likely to be operational in the near future. This provides not just pleasure, but also a place for jobs and government capital for this underdeveloped republic.
